Question 101813: The crop yield, Y, (in bushels) for various amounts, x (in pounds per 100 square feet) of fertilizer used in 18 different plots of land is as shown in the table below. The graph of the data can be modeled by Y(x)=-0.017x^2+1.0765x + 3.8939.
Plot / Fertilizer (x) / Yield - Y(x)
1 0 4
2 0 6
3 5 10
4 5 7
5 10 12
6 10 10
7 15 15
8 15 17
9 20 18
10 20 21
11 25 20
12 25 21
13 30 21
14 30 22
15 35 21
16 35 20
17 40 19
18 40 19
based on the data and the quadratic model, what is the optimal amount of fertilizer to apply for maximum crop yield? Explain or show how you decided.

The crop yield, Y, (in bushels) for various amounts, x (in pounds per 100 square feet) of fertilizer used in 18 different plots of land is as shown in the table below. The graph of the data can be modeled by
Y(x)=-0.017x^2+1.0765x + 3.8939
What is the optimal amount of fertilizer to apply for maximum crop yield?
------------
The max crop yield occurs when x=-b/2a = -[1.0765]/[-2*0.017] = 31 lbs per 100
square feet)
